This, but in addition the poor reviews tend to stem from the fact that each installment of the New Frontier Pass focuses on one aspect of the game which means only a segment of players will like it. So instead of just waiting for something they do like to come a few months later, a lot of people who didn't get something they wanted post negative reviews.
As someone who plays a lot of the game but not all, I can say everything I've experienced in the small DLCs has been fun for at least a few games, and the stuff I was specifically interested in has become regular additions to almost every game I play.
I'm not interested in scenarios or multiplayer, but I don't complain when the devs take time to add those, like they did a few times in the last year.
